What it is, How it works

Hair testing is recognized as an influential resource for identifying drug and alcohol consumption. Hair offers a long-term record of alcohol and other drugs by holding biomarkers within the threads of the growing hair strand. When collected near the scalp, hair can deliver up to a roughly 3-month detection period for alcohol and other drugs. Hair is easy to gather, relatively hard to tamper with, and straightforward to transport.

A sample measuring 1.5 inches of approximately 200 hair strands (comparable to a #2 pencil) nearest to the scalp will yield 100mg of hair, the preferred quantity for screening and verification. For EtG, supplements, and/or assessments above 10 panels, 150mg of the specimen is suggested. We advise measuring the specimen with a jeweler’s scale. If scalp hair is not available, a matching quantity of body hair can be gathered. When mentioning head hair, we mean scalp hair exclusively. Body hair includes all other hair categories (facial, axillary, etc.).

Process Overview

The laboratory handling of a drug test outcome is composed of four essential steps: Accessioning, Screening, Extraction, and Confirmation.

Accessioning entails the preliminary processing of a sample into a laboratory’s system. This process verifies that the sample was properly sealed and sent, assigning a random LAN (Laboratory Accessioning Number), and completing any additional data entry not supplied by an electronic chain of custody mechanism.

Screening executes a rapid initial search for drugs of abuse. While Screening serves as a cost-efficient method to exclude drug usage for the majority of samples, a positive screening result must be verified to be valid in legal proceedings. Any samples showing a presumptive positive in Screening require a secondary confirmation.

If a sample exhibits a presumptive positive during the Screening phase, additional hair is extracted from the original specimen and prepared for Extraction. During this phase, drugs are drawn from hair at much lower concentrations than in other techniques (e.g., urine or oral fluid), which explains why hair drug screening is the most challenging method to conduct.

Verification of any positive screening result is achieved through GC/MS, GC/MS/MS or LC/MS/MS. All presumptive positive samples undergo washing prior to confirmation as necessary. The full laboratory process from Accessioning to Confirmation undergoes scrutiny under both the CAP (College of American Pathologists) Hair standard and accreditation to ISO / IEC 17025 criteria.

Advantages of hair drug testing:

  • Extended detection period: Hair drug tests identify drug use up to 90 days, as opposed to urine tests, which have a shorter detection period.
  • Challenging to manipulate: Cheating a hair drug test is exceedingly difficult, making the results more credible.
  • Delivers historical insight: It reveals a history of drug use spanning time, not just recent occurrences.

Limitations:

  • Inability to detect recent use: Drugs become noticeable in hair around 5-7 days after use.
  • Expense: Hair drug tests tend to be pricier than other drug testing approaches.
  • Result variability: Elements like hair color and unique hair growth rates can influence the drug metabolite concentration in the hair.

Note: While frequently labeled as "hair follicle tests", the assessment actually evaluates the hair strand and not the follicle beneath the scalp.
